Y A GEORGE II SILVER MOUNTED TORTOISESHELL OVAL TOBACCO BOX UNMARKED, CIRCA 1737 The oval silver mounted tortoiseshell cover applied with a male bust, the silver body engraved 'Thos. Hatton', 'Dover' and '1737, with a tortoiseshell base 10.5cm (4 1/4in) long Provenance: Woolley & Wallis, Silver & Objects of Vertu, 17th July 2018, Lot 570 Condition Report: Unmarked Engraving lightly rubbed Rubbing to the bust Cover fits well Chip to the tortoiseshell base Wobbles Light scratches and wear commensurate with age and use Condition Report Disclaimer
